## Load Testing the Cartfield Checkout Flow

Plugin authors must load test against the Cartfield sandbox, never production. The harness reads its config from `loadtest.env`: set CHECKOUT_TARGET to the sandbox host, VUS to at most 200, and RAMP_SECONDS to 120 or higher so the rate limiter doesn't flag your run as abuse. Results are written to the shared metrics bucket, and failed transactions are replayed automatically once. The harness authenticates to the sandbox gateway with a test credential, which you set on the next line.

env line for fafof-fahag: LEDGER_TOKEN5=f8790

Stattler, our deploy-status bot, posts to the #releases channel on Murkwood Chat. If it goes quiet, restart the worker on the ops box. It reads config at boot only; no hot reload. Config lives in the env file next to the binary. The bot needs the chat platform's bot credential to post. Append that credential to the env file before restarting.

secret setting of hawep-yahig: LEDGER_TOKEN29=41b5d6315371c92885eaeb077fb63

# Building Access: Mail Room Relocation

As of this month, the mail room at Ashenford Place has moved from its former position near the west entrance to Room 1.14 on the first floor, adjacent to the Garrick Meeting Suite. Visiting contractors expecting deliveries should check in at the main reception first, where the Ashenford Facilities team will confirm any held parcels. From reception, take the north stairs one flight up and follow the signage. The door to Room 1.14 is secured; enter using the pass code provided below.

staff pass of kawip-hawef = bdg-QLP-2